SMITHFIELD - Celestine Savage, widow of Willie G. Savage, passed away on Aug. 19, 2008.She was a member of New Bethany United Church of Christ, Smithfield.Mrs. Savage is survived by eight daughters, Constance Scott (Oscar), Jean Uzzle, Artis Addison, Glen Jenkins, Vivian Stith (James), Debra...
